Historic treatments for rheumatoid arthritis have included gold salts, acupuncture, a diet consisting of apples or rhubarb, nutmeg, nettles, bee venom, bracelets made of copper, prayer, rest, tooth extractions, fasting, honey, vitamins, insulin, snow collected on Christmas, magnets, and electric convulsion therapy.

Many people have small pouches in their colons that bulge outward through weak spots. Each pouch is called a diverticulum. About 10% of Americans older than age 40 years have diverticulosis, which, when the pouches become infected or inflamed, is called diverticulitis. The main cause of diverticular disease is a low-fiber diet.
